The preterite of crear is used to express when you created something at a specific point in time. For example, when you want to say “She created this artwork last year” – “Ella creó esta obra de arte el año pasado.”
This verb follows the regular -ar conjugation pattern in the preterite tense. Note that the ‘e’ in the stem is maintained throughout all conjugations.
Conjugations
Conjugations of Crear (to create) in the Preterite (Past) Tense tense (Castilian Spanish):
Pronoun | Conjugation |
---|---|
Yo | creé |
Tú | creaste |
Él / Ella / Usted | creó |
Nosotros / Nosotras | creamos |
Vosotros / Vosotras | creasteis |
Ellos / Ellas / Ustedes | crearon |

Usage of Crear in the Preterite (Past) Tense
The Preterite of crear indicates completed acts of creation.
To create/make: Used for completing the creation of something, for example Creé una nueva receta (I created a new recipe), or Crearon un programa exitoso (They created a successful program).
To establish/found: Refers to founding or establishing something, for example Creó su propia empresa (She created her own company).
Examples
Examples of Crear in the Preterite (Past) Tense
El artista creó una obra maestra. (The artist created a masterpiece.)
Creamos un nuevo proyecto juntos. (We created a new project together.)
La empresa creó mil empleos nuevos. (The company created a thousand new jobs.)
¿Quién creó esta aplicación? (Who created this application?)
Creaste algo realmente especial. (You created something really special.)
Los científicos crearon una nueva vacuna. (The scientists created a new vaccine.)
Creé mi propio negocio el año pasado. (I created my own business last year.)
El equipo creó una solución innovadora. (The team created an innovative solution.)
Crearon un ambiente muy agradable. (They created a very pleasant atmosphere.)
¿Cómo creaste ese diseño? (How did you create that design?)
El gobierno creó nuevas leyes. (The government created new laws.)
Creamos recuerdos inolvidables. (We created unforgettable memories.)
La naturaleza creó este paisaje único. (Nature created this unique landscape.)
Creé una cuenta nueva ayer. (I created a new account yesterday.)
El chef creó un plato original. (The chef created an original dish.)

Synonyms
The Preterite tense is also known as the Simple Past, Past Simple, Definite Past, Absolute Past, or Past Tense Indicative in English, and as Pretérito Perfecto Simple, Pretérito Indefinido, Pretérito Simple, Pasado Simple, or Pretérito de Indicativo in Spanish.
